50 Things To Do To Be More Hobo Chic (Effortless, Cozy & Budget-Friendly)

50 simple, budget-friendly ideas to become more hobo chic.
Think: effortless boho + grunge + cozy layers + earthy textures. It’s carefree, creative, and stylish without trying too hard.

1. Wear oversized sweaters

Think slouchy, comfy, slightly worn-in.

2. Layer EVERYTHING

Tank + loose tee + cardigan + scarf = instant vibe.

3. Mix textures

Knits, denim, fringe, linen, crochet.

4. Choose earthy, muted tones

Beige, olive, rust, charcoal, cream.

5. Wear loose, flowy skirts or maxi dresses

Especially with boots or sneakers.

6. Add distressed denim

Ripped jeans, frayed hems, faded jackets.

7. Shop secondhand

Thrift stores are the heart of hobo chic.

8. Wear oversized cardigans

Chunky knits, uneven lengths, draped silhouettes.

9. Try patchwork pieces

Patch jeans, mixed-fabric jackets, DIY stitches.

10. Use scarves as belts, shawls, or headwraps

Multi-purpose and very aesthetic.

11. Layer jewelry

Beads, wooden bracelets, pendants, rings.

12. Choose comfy boots

Combat boots, suede boots, ankle boots — slightly worn is perfect.

13. Mix prints mindfully

Florals + stripes, paisley + neutrals.

14. Wear beanies or floppy hats

Soft, relaxed, and cozy.

15. Add fingerless gloves

Practical and gives that “creative wanderer” look.

16. Wear crossbody slouch bags

Fringe, canvas, woven, or oversized.

17. Try ponchos or kimonos

Flowy layers add immediate boho chic.

18. Choose natural fabrics

Cotton, wool, hemp, linen.

19. Go oversized with outerwear

Long coats, loose trench coats, boyfriend fit jackets.

20. Add vintage pieces

Old band tees, retro jackets, grandma sweaters.


HAIR & BEAUTY

21. Keep hair a little undone

Loose waves, messy bun, soft braids.

22. Use hair scarves or wraps

Adds colour and personality.

23. Natural makeup look

Dewy skin, soft eyeliner, nude lip.

24. Try henna freckles or soft bronzer

Gives an earthy, sun-kissed hobo vibe.

25. Wear earthy nail colours

Brown, terracotta, olive, muted mauve.


ACCESSORIES & DETAILS

26. Add thrifted or DIY jewelry

Leather cords, beads, feathers, charms.

27. Use bandanas

Around neck, hair, wrist, or bag handle.

28. Wear layered necklaces of different lengths

Long pendants + short chokers = perfect.

29. Carry a woven or macrame bag

Boho texture adds interest.

30. Try mismatched earrings

Perfect for quirky hobo chic style.
